What happened
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enant due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after serving a valid Notice to End Tenancy Early for Non-payment of Rent (N4 Notice), which the tenant did not void by paying the arrears. The tenant was still in possession of the rental unit on the hearing date.
The ruling
The tenancy is terminated unless the Tenant pays $12,861 by February 18, 2023 to void the order. If the Tenant does not pay, the Tenant must move out by February 18, 2023 and pay the Landlord $12,039.34 plus daily compensation of $47.18 per day starting February 14, 2023 until the Tenant moves out.
